Market for Biodegradable Polymers Polymers used in extrusion coatings in the United States fall into five main categories: polyhydroxyalkanoates (PHA), polylactic acid (PLA), polybutylene succinate (PBS), polyester-based blends, and starch blends. Each type addresses specific environmental and performance needs in the packaging and food service industries. PHAs are known for their biodegradability in a variety of environments and have attracted attention due to the versatility of their barrier properties and compatibility with existing extrusion coating equipment. Made from renewable resources such as cornstarch and sugar cane, PLA has excellent transparency and printability, making it suitable for applications that require high visual appeal.
PBS and polyester-based blends were selected for their excellent mechanical properties and moisture resistance, which are essential for packaging applications. These materials offer a balance between functionality and environmental impact and meet stringent regulatory requirements. Starch blends, on the other hand, are highly valued for their cost-effectiveness and biocompatibility and are often used in disposable packaging solutions. The demand for biodegradable polymers in extrusion coatings continues to increase as consumer awareness and regulatory pressures drive the industry to prioritize sustainable alternatives to traditional plastics.
